while
~할 때까지 반복
break : if, while 과 같은 어느 조건문에서 빠져나올 때 사용
continue : while 문에서 사용할 경우, 다음 코드를 실행하지 않고, while 문의 처음으로 돌아감
for
for 변수 in 리스트(or 튜플, 문자열)
리스트에서 하나씩 변수로 빼냄
이중 for 문의 경우, 안 쪽 for문이 끝나야 다시 바깥쪽 for문이 실행됨
range
range(a,b) 란, a이상 b미만을 뜻함
end
print( , end="")
print의 옵션 개념, 값을 프린트할 때, 공백이나 다른 조건을 작성할 수 있음
리스트 내포 형식
일반적으로 작성하는 코드를 한 줄로 표기할 수 있음
1번
result = [x * y for x in range(2,10) for y in range(1,10)]
2번
result = []
for x in range(2,10):
for y in range(1,10):
result.append(x*y)
1번과 2번은 동일한 코드